Vacancy Circular No. 1 of 2026 Assistant Administration Officer
Vacancy Details
VACANCY:
ASSISTANT ADMINISTRATION OFFICER
1 POST (REGIONAL EDUCATION OFFICE)
Applications are invited from suitably qualified citizens for the above posts in the Ministry of Child Welfare and Basic Education tenable at North West Region.
Salary and Leave
SALARY SCALE: B1/2 (P77,184 – P108,228 per annum)
LEAVE: 20 working days per annum
Benefits
Optional medical aid scheme with the Botswana Public Officers Medical Aid Scheme BPOMAS, government pays 50 percent and employee pays 50 percent
Contributory pension scheme, government contributes 15 percent and employee contributes 5 percent
Qualifications and Experience
QUALIFICATIONS:
Certificate in Public Administration, Human Resources Management or a related field plus 2 years’ relevant experience
EXPERIENCE:
2 years satisfactory service as Senior Administration Assistant B3/2
Main Purpose of the Job
Performs all administrative support duties including filing of administrative and payment related records
Prepares payment vouchers, collects revenue, and provides routine administrative support on finance and accounts
Supervises subordinate staff
Provides administrative support at district, regional, and headquarters levels
Verifies attendance records and payment of vouchers
Issues casualty returns, processes leave applications, and updates leave records
Updates CPMS information
Competencies
Working with People
Planning and Organizing
Communication and Writing
Delivering Results and Meeting Customer Expectations
Vacancy Circular No. 2 of 2026 Senior Accounts Assistant
Vacancy Details
VACANCY: SENIOR ACCOUNTS ASSISTANT
Applications are invited from suitably qualified citizens for the above post in the Ministry of Child Welfare and Basic Education tenable in North West Region at Gumare sub region.
Salary and Leave
SALARY SCALE: B1/2 (P77,184 – P108,228 per annum)
LEAVE: 20 working days per annum
Benefits
Optional medical aid scheme with BPOMAS, government pays 50 percent and employee pays 50 percent
Contributory pension scheme, government contributes 15 percent and employee contributes 5 percent
Qualifications and Experience
QUALIFICATIONS:
Certificate in Accountancy and Business Studies or Equivalent
EXPERIENCE:
Two years satisfactory service as Accounts Assistant on B3/2 salary scale
Duties
Provide accounting and administrative support to the school
Writing of ledgers
Preparing of payment vouchers
Ensures prompt collection of revenues and dues
Daily entry of Industrial Class attendance registers
Assist in the recruitment and payment of casual labourers
Manage bursar’s office when required
Undertake related duties to meet service needs
Competencies
Customer Focus
Effective communication
Good planning skills
Good interpersonal skills
Team player
Procedural Awareness
Computer Literacy

Application Requirements and Submission
Applicants should quote the relevant vacancy circular number and provide accurate documentation.
Required Details
Full name, addresses, date and place of birth
Brief summary of previous relevant work experience, Resume or Curriculum Vitae
Three traceable references not older than six months
Certified copies of academic and professional certificates
Certified copy of Omang
Serving Officers
Date of first appointment
Present post and date of appointment
Incomplete submissions risk rejection during screening.
